Miter Saw Mastery: Cutting Aluminium with Precision

Achieving perfect cuts of aluminum with your miter here saw demands specific techniques. Unlike wood, this material tends to melt to the teeth, potentially resulting in a jagged edge and reverse action . To circumvent this, always use a micro-tooth blade designed for non-ferrous metals . Lowering the cutting speed – that's how fast you push the material into the blade – is vital; a slow approach yields much more accurate results. Furthermore , lubricating the blade with a cutting fluid can reduce sticking and improve the overall cut appearance .

Choosing the Right Miter Saw for Alloy Projects

When working with metal projects, selecting the ideal miter tool is vital. Standard miter devices can tear and mark the soft material, leading to uneven cuts and scrap pieces. Look for a tool with a micro-tooth blade specifically made for light metals, or consider a friction-cutting miter tool which avoids heat buildup and reduces the risk of bending . The feature to fine-tune blade RPM is also beneficial for achieving clean, clean cuts.
